Applications based on WebKit or Blink, such as Safari and Chrome, support a number of special WebKit extensions to CSS. These extensions are generally prefixed with -webkit-. Most -webkit- prefixed properties also work with an -apple- prefix. The CSS filter property provides access to effects like blur or color shifting on an element’s rendering before the element is displayed.
